summaryrefslogtreecommitdiffstats
path: root/lass/2configs/websites/lassulus.nix
diff options
context:
space:
mode:
Diffstat (limited to 'lass/2configs/websites/lassulus.nix')
-rw-r--r--lass/2configs/websites/lassulus.nix20
1 files changed, 3 insertions, 17 deletions
diff --git a/lass/2configs/websites/lassulus.nix b/lass/2configs/websites/lassulus.nix
index 411234b8..9440413a 100644
--- a/lass/2configs/websites/lassulus.nix
+++ b/lass/2configs/websites/lassulus.nix
@@ -9,8 +9,6 @@ let
in {
imports = [
./default.nix
- ../git.nix
- ./ref.ptkk.de
];
security.acme = {
@@ -66,23 +64,11 @@ in {
locations."= /gpg.pub".extraConfig = ''
alias ${pkgs.writeText "pub" config.krebs.users.lass-yubikey.pgp.pubkeys.default};
'';
+ locations."= /ip".extraConfig = ''
+ return 200 '$remote_addr';
+ '';
};
- security.acme.certs."cgit.lassul.us" = {
- email = "lassulus@lassul.us";
- webroot = "/var/lib/acme/acme-challenge";
- group = "nginx";
- };
- services.nginx.virtualHosts.cgit = {
- serverName = "cgit.lassul.us";
- addSSL = true;
- sslCertificate = "/var/lib/acme/cgit.lassul.us/fullchain.pem";
- sslCertificateKey = "/var/lib/acme/cgit.lassul.us/key.pem";
- locations."/.well-known/acme-challenge".extraConfig = ''
- root /var/lib/acme/acme-challenge;
- '';
- };
}
-